How they compare

Malaysia currently reports 881,750 current US$ per square kilometre against 870,672 current US$ per square kilometre in Comoros, a difference of 11,078 current US$ per square kilometre.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 44 shared years of data; in 1980 it was Comoros ahead.

Comoros ranks 65th and Malaysia ranks 64th of 185 countries.

Across the 5 decades both report, Comoros averaged higher in 3 and Malaysia in 2.

Head to head by decade

Decade Comoros Malaysia Difference Ahead
1980s 132,902 current US$ per square kilometre 61,818 current US$ per square kilometre 71,084 current US$ per square kilometre Comoros
1990s 207,782 current US$ per square kilometre 130,970 current US$ per square kilometre 76,812 current US$ per square kilometre Comoros
2000s 337,145 current US$ per square kilometre 253,197 current US$ per square kilometre 83,948 current US$ per square kilometre Comoros
2010s 594,651 current US$ per square kilometre 639,610 current US$ per square kilometre 44,958 current US$ per square kilometre Malaysia
2020s 780,472 current US$ per square kilometre 826,128 current US$ per square kilometre 45,657 current US$ per square kilometre Malaysia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
